Filter coffee machine makes machines

A filter coffee machine produces filter coffee by passing hot filtrated water through grounds of coffee. The grounds absorb the water and release flavour compounds which are then extracted into the cup of coffee. They come in a range of sizes, ranging from three to 13 cups, and are available with a variety of options.

A few of the models we tested have insulation to keep your brew warm without the need for an energy-hungry hotplate. Other models have an adjustable timer that runs 24 hours a day, so you can set it up at night and get up to a pot of coffee waiting to enjoy. Other useful features include a long-lasting, reusable filter that minimizes the amount of paper waste and a easily-observable water tank.

Some filter coffee machines are compact enough to fit on a tiny kitchen worktop, while others have bigger footprints. Some models have a removable tank to make refilling and cleaning easy. Some have fixed tanks that could limit the space you use.

Espresso machines

Drawing inspiration from manual coffee makers found in cafes Espresso machines are able to make a variety of specialty drinks with just the click of the button. They require a little more effort to use than other types of machine - users must grind their own beans, measure and tamp their grounds and steam milk in separate batches - however our test participants found that the results made the extra effort worth it.

Aiming for the same level of quality as a barista espresso machine, an espresso machine makes use of hot water and up to nine bars of pressure to create a stronger, more concentrated drink. They can have an inbuilt milk frother to create cappuccinos or macchiatos. They're typically more expensive than other coffee machines but they provide a premium, high-end experience.

They are a popular option for those looking to recreate the cafe-style experience at home. Bean-to-cup machines

The best bean to cup machines crush whole roasted coffee beans at the touch of a button, and then make the beans into a variety of drinks. This can be accomplished with the push of the button. Many also allow you to save your coffee preferences so that every time you turn the machine on, it will automatically create the beverage you want. They can be connected to home tech networks or apps to provide greater flexibility.

You can often control the finer points like the temperature and pressure of the extraction. This gives you total control over the flavor of every cup. They're often designed to produce a better quality coffee than capsule or pod machines. This is because a good bean-to-cup machine grinds the beans to a precise consistency, then force hot water through them at the precise pressure and duration required to maximise flavour.

There are also plenty of coffee makers that have milk foaming capabilities. This is great for creating the rich and textural layers in a cappuccino, or latte. However it can be a little tricky to get these right. Once you've got the machine mastered it can make drinks that are at home in a specialty coffee shop.

Pod or capsule machines

The most effective pod machines eliminate the guesswork and deliver regular results without hassle. These models dispense capsules containing instant or ground coffee machines ireland (click the up coming internet site), tea and other beverages. They are a good option for those not as familiar with espresso machines or bean-to-cup machines coffee and are simply looking for an easy solution to the morning commute.

They're an excellent choice for those who wish to test various blends without spending huge quantities of beans, and they're cheaper than other alternatives if you don't use the machine as frequently. They are less versatile and don't yield the same quality of coffee as the bean-to cup machine.
